life_free
(Littlewormqura)
1
如何将view的值传递到model?]
view中的admin.php
<form id="serverform" name="serverform">
<select name="server" id="server" onchange="return chooseServer();">
<option value="aa1">aa1 Server</option>
<option value="aa2">aa2 Server</option>
</select>
现在我需要把下拉框选定的值传递给model/users.php 的一个自定义静态变量public static $db ,如何操作呢?万分感谢!!!
hehbhehb
(Hehbhehb)
2
onchange时下拉框的值是先到controller中的, controller收到后,再传给model吧
life_free
(Littlewormqura)
3
谢谢啊!那能不能直接将值传过去呢? 有什么方法么?
这是我的 chooseServer()方法
function chooseServer(){
var server = document.getElementById('server').value;
alert (server);
<?php
echo CHtml::ajax(
array(
"data" => "js:{servers : server}",
"type"=>"POST",
"success" => "function(psw) { alert(psw);}"
)
);
?>
// history.go(0);
}